Sing Along
LOCK HAVEN — Enjoy a Sing-Along with the Twisted Racquet Tears on Sunday, June 21, from 2-4 p.m., at Covenant United Methodist Church, 44 W. Main St., Lock Haven. This event is part of the Alzheimer’s Association’s Longest Day celebration to bring awareness to the disease. A free-will offering will be taken and a basket raffle will be held to raise funds for the Alzheimer’s Association. Call Fran at 570-263-2084 for more info. The church has free parking and a handicap accessible ramp.

Summer Outdoor
Concerts Series
SNYDERTOWN — St. Mark Lutheran Church’s Summer Outdoor Concert series returns Friday, June 26. The monthly series features music from local and regional musicians playing under the pavilion at St. Mark, 850 Snydertown Road, Howard.
On June 26, singer/songwriter Mike Weyrauch will return for a second consecutive year. Weyrauch plays popular and praise music and has performed in popular area venues such as 814 Cider Works and Shy Bear Brewery. The evening begins at 6 p.m. with food and the fire pit started to roast hot dogs, Smores and more. Music begins at 6:30 p.m. You are invited to bring a lawn chair or blanket, food to share if you like and are able, and to just enjoy some music and time with those of our community.
If there is rain, the concert will be moved indoors.
The other summer concerts this year are Woody Wolfe, Jr. returning to St. Mark on July 17 and Fishers of Men, who are performing for the first time at St. Mark on Aug. 14.
